The Smurf Run - Wales
The Smurf Run is organised by Saturn Running at Dare Valley Country Park in Aberdare. The event is a seven hour Time Challenge that lets participants choose how many laps to complete. The minimum completed distance to be an official finisher is 3 km.
The course uses well maintained footpaths around the country park with views of the surrounding countryside and is described as suitable for a road trainer. The regular lap measures 7 km (4.37 miles) but may be changed to a 3.28 mile loop depending on course conditions. There are 3 km and 5 km turn points on the lap to enable compliance with UK Athletics age rules.
Distances offered include:
- 3 km minimum (part of a lap)
- 7 km lap (4.37 miles; may change to 3.28 miles)
- Half marathon - 3 laps
- Marathon - 6 laps
- 50 km and ultra options
- Time Challenge - seven hour window
Finishers who complete at least 3 km receive a themed medal. Additional distance pins are awarded for half-marathon and longer distances and are attached to the medal ribbon. Finishers receive a goody bag with a vegan option. Aid and drinks tables are available at the start and finish of each lap. Venue facilities include toilets, a nearby cafe, free parking and a non secure bag drop. Bone conducting headphones only are permitted.
